Bruce Willis wasn't acting in those movies, though. He would only be there for a few days each movie, so each of those weird, fake movies had to figure out how to shoot around him, and work those few days into the shooting schedule. He'd show up, be "Bruce Willis" for your movie, and collect his paycheck. Looking back, it's clear why, but he wasn't doing it for the love of the game. He was doing it to shore up some money while he still could. And good for him, that's a good plan.

That's not what Cage is doing. He's clearly giving it his all each time, even if sometimes it may make you go, "What the gently caress, for this?!" They're not similar situations.

It reminds me of that story Brad Pitt told about shooting Once Upon a Time in Hollywood, where they shot a scene a couple of times (I think it was the scene where Pitt's character gets to the ranch), and Tarantino knew they got it on the last take, but decided to shoot it one more time for fun. QT yelled out, "And why?" And everyone, including QT, yelled out, "Because we loving making movies!"

Cage really loves making movies.

A decade or so ago Disney developed a system for making CG look like traditional animation and showed it off in that paper planes short you’ve probably all seen. I saw an interview with a Disney animator who was asked why the studio never used it for a feature, the answer was that the studio execs felt that Disney needed to maintain an aesthetic that was consistent across their brand and that the look Pixar had developed would be that going forward (it always seemed like dumb reasoning to me because every CG animation studio had that same look, how could it help consumers identify a Disney product).

Anyway in the last few years we’ve seen Sony have great success with their own take on that approach and other studios have followed suit.

I could be wrong, but 5the aesthetic in that trailer feels like an attempt to compromise with that trend while still maintaining their “visual identity.”

But whatever the reason, it looks awful.
